Taisho Cave in Akiyoshidai is a fantastic underground space created by stalactites. It is popular as a three-dimensional cave with a large difference in elevation, giving you the feeling of being an explorer.
Taisho Cave is a magnificent limestone cave created by nature, located in Akiyoshidai Quasi-National Park in Mine City, Yamaguchi Prefecture. It is one of the three major limestone caves in Akiyoshidai, along with Akiyoshido Cave and Kagekiyo Cave, but unlike other limestone caves, it is characterized by its three-dimensional structure with different heights.

It has a multi-layered structure connected by numerous subsidiary caves and shafts, and by going up and down the passages and stairs, you can experience the feeling of exploring underground. The stalactites hanging from the ceiling and the stalagmites extending from the floor create a fantastic sight when lit up.

Inside the cave, there are attractions such as "Cow Hiding," "Entrance to Hell," and "Lion Rock," each with its own unique shape. In particular, the curtains of stalactites formed over a long period of time and the strange rocks polished by water make you feel the greatness of the power of nature. The temperature inside the cave remains constant throughout the year, so it feels cool in the summer and warm in the winter, making it a comfortable place to visit all year round. After exploring the cave, we also recommend taking a stroll around the karst plateau of Akiyoshidai.

It takes about 30 minutes on foot to go around the entire cave.
